The full security model, threat model, and invariant catalogue (I1–I30, with I28 reserved) live in [`docs/SECURITY.md`](../docs/SECURITY.md) and the central [nimbus-security](https://github.com/nimbus-agent/nimbus-security) repository. ## Reporting a vulnerability Please **do not** open a public issue for security reports. Use GitHub's private vulnerability reporting — the **Security** tab → [**Report a vulnerability**](https://github.com/nimbus-agent/Nimbus/security/advisories/new). It is the only reporting channel: Nimbus publishes no security email address and no PGP key, because a solo maintainer's unmonitored inbox drops reports silently. Nimbus is maintained by one person as a side project, so there is no guaranteed response time and no SLA. Reports are typically read within a week and prioritised by severity, and we will agree a coordinated-disclosure timeline with you.
